Patti McCarty, a talented actress, entered this world on February 11, 1921, in the charming town of Healdsburg, California, USA, a place renowned for its picturesque wine country and rich cultural heritage.
With a passion for the performing arts, McCarty's early life was likely filled with the thrill of bringing characters to life on stage and screen, a skill that would later serve her well in her illustrious career.
Her impressive filmography boasts a range of notable titles, including Fuzzy Settles Down (1944),Outlaws of the Plains (1946),and Fighting Valley (1943),each showcasing her remarkable acting abilities and dedication to her craft.
Tragically, Patti McCarty's life came to a close on July 7, 1985, in the beautiful city of Honolulu, Hawaii, USA, a place known for its stunning natural beauty, rich cultural heritage, and warm hospitality.
